Miniature 11.4 x 9.6 x 2.5mm SMD package
Frequency range: 200.01MHz to 800.0MHz
Supply voltage 3.3 Volts
Frequency stability from ±1ppm over -30 to +75°C
RoHS compliant
EMW42GT Series TCXO
HCMOS 4 pad SMD, 'W' Group
EMW42GT - OUTLINES AND DIMENSIONS
DESCRIPTION
EMW42GT series TCXOs are packaged in a 4 pad SMD package with
trimmer. With squarewave (CMOS) output, tolerances are available
from ±1.0ppm over -30° to +75°C. The part has a 0.01mF decoupling
capacitor built in.
